Tyrannous

/ˈtɪɹənəs/ · adjective

Meaning

Tyrannical, despotic or oppressive..

Example Sentences

As life wears on and finds no rest, The individual in each breast Is tyrannous to sunder them.
[…] that Elfe, That man and beast with powre imperious Subdeweth to his kingdome tyrannous:
Yield up, O love, thy crown and hearted throne To tyrannous hate!
It is extraordinary that as the wicked arts of this regicide and tyrannous faction increase in number, variety, and atrocity, the desire of punishing them becomes more and more faint […]
